Question: Which of the following is a disease caused by a virus? (2021)

Options:

  1. Tuberculosis
  2. Malaria
  3. HIV/AIDS
  4. Typhoid

Correct Answer: HIV/AIDS

Exam Year: 2021

Solution:

HIV/AIDS is caused by the Human Immunodeficiency Virus (HIV), which is a virus.
